Morgan County pride: 12 names added to county hall of fame

MARTINSVILLE - The Morgan County Hall of Fame now features 12 new names as the county celebrates 200 years of existence.

A public induction ceremony was held at the Morgan County Public Library in Martinsville last week to celebrate the achievements of current and past Morgan County residents who rose to prominence in their respective fields.

The newly chosen recipients include: Gary Bettenhausen, Richard Bray, Sally Butler, Eliza Callis-Scott, Christie Loren (Habig) Dunham, Marshall H. Goss, Dave Keister, Nina Mason Pulliam, Ruth Rusie, William Shields, Jerry Sichting and John Vawter.

The celebratory evening began with remarks from David Reddick, who served on the committee responsible for deciding which nominations should be inducted. Nearly 30 nominations were reviewed by Morgan County Public Library Director Krista Ledbetter, David Reddick, Janice Bolinger, Chip Keller and Ellen Wilson-Pruitt, all members of the selection committee.

"I can tell you from being on the committee and reading all the nominations we received, it was a very tough job selecting the 12 people that we did because all two dozen were certainly worthy of this honor," Reddick said.

Ledbetter shared her pride in having so many talented and driven individuals connected to the county.

"We have business people, we have educators, philanthropists, journalists and athletes. It is amazing to me what a far reach our local county has throughout the state and the world," Ledbetter said. "That was one of our main criteria when we do the hall of fame is that the nominee must have reached beyond the borders of Morgan County and let the rest of the world know what a wonderful place Morgan County is."

Hall of Fame History

The Morgan County Hall of Fame was first established in 1976 to pay tribute to America's Bicentennial celebrations at the time. 31 inductees were awarded a place in the hall of fame that year. An additional three honorees were included in 1986. The hall of fame wall in the library was last updated in 2012 when eight more names were added.

After the latest indication ceremony, the hall of fame now features 54 individuals who have been recognized for their contributions within Morgan County, across Indiana and nationally.
